The groundspoiler bypassvalve is mechanical linked to a sensor on RH main LDG. It could very vell be, the same sensor that gives input to Air/Ground system.
So if this sensor is jammed by the (faulty) open valve, LDG Lever Lock Out solenoid will not open, due to A/G system logic, and gear lever cannot move up.

I could be wrong, but it seems like logic to me.
